
Taylor Hall is a Canadian professional ice hockey left winger who plays for the Carolina Hurricanes in the NHL. He was born on November 14, 1991, in Calgary, Alberta, and moved to Kingston, Ontario, at age 13. Hall began his junior career with the Windsor Spitfires in the OHL during the 2007–08 season and was named both OHL and CHL Rookie of the Year. He won the Stafford Smythe Memorial Trophy as the MVP of the 2009 Memorial Cup.
Hall was selected first overall by the Edmonton Oilers in the 2010 NHL Draft and made his debut in the 2010–11 season. In June 2016, he was traded to the New Jersey Devils. In his second season with the Devils, Hall became the first player in franchise history to win the Hart Memorial Trophy as the NHL's most valuable player.
